Step1: Determine the number of valence electrons of sulfur

Sulfur (\(S\)) is in Group 16 of the periodic table. The number of valence electrons of an element in Group \(n\) is \(n - 10\) (for \(n> 10\)). So, for \(S\) (\(n = 16\)), the number of valence electrons is \(6\).
